Intelligent Apps Market - Regional Analysis

North America Market Insights

North America is projected to contribute a 38.3% share of the intelligent apps market by 2035, spurred by a high density of technology firms and early adoption of cloud computing and AI. The region hosts a thriving startup ecosystem of mature players that are experimenting with what is possible with intelligent apps. The healthy venture capital ecosystem and availability of world-class research institutions are also fueling the market's growth.

The U.S. is a significant market in North America, with a rich tradition of innovation and a big and diverse base of consumers. The U.S. government is also a key driver of the market, with huge investments in research and development of AI. In January 2025, the U.S.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) published its FY2024-2026 Cybersecurity Strategic Plan. This plan harmonizes federal civilian cybersecurity activity with collective defense principles and secure-by-design, which facilitates more secure intelligent applications.

Canada market for intelligent apps continues to expand on the back of a robust tech industry and government efforts toward digital innovation. The government of Canada is funding AI research and has established a welcoming environment for startups and tech firms. In October 2024, the Canadian Centre for Cyber Security officially announced the publication of its National Cyber Threat Assessment for 2025-2026. The assessment gives Canadians important predictions and mitigation priorities, guiding risk management strategies and promoting the use of secure intelligent applications.

Asia Pacific Market Insights

Asia Pacific intelligent apps market is expected to rise at an impressive CAGR of 40% over the forecast period, driven by the region's economic growth and mobile-first population. The surge in smartphone adoption and rising demand for digital services are building a gigantic market for intelligent apps. Regional governments are also heavily investing in digital infrastructure and encouraging the construction of smart cities, which is further stimulating the demand for intelligent technologies.

China is a leader in the APAC market, with a massive population and a government that is heavily invested in becoming an AI hub. Technology firms are leading in AI innovation, producing a diverse array of smart apps for both consumer and enterprise purposes. In May 2024, China's Cyberspace Administration emphasized its continued oversight actions and governance efforts regarding AI and data security. These initiatives are part of a larger drive to promote the safe deployment and regulation of new technologies, influencing the creation of smart apps in the nation.

India is another prominent market in the region, boasting a fast-expanding digital economy and a vast and young population. The government of India's "Digital India" campaign is targeting to make the country a digitally empowered nation, which is generating a high demand for smart apps. In October 2023, the Indian National Security Council Secretariat organized the 'Bharat NCX 2023', a national-level cybersecurity exercise. This activity educated senior management and technical staff from key industries on modern cyber threats and incident management, encouraging a safer environment for the uptake of intelligent apps. 

Europe Market Insights

Europe intelligent apps market is estimated to record continued growth, fueled by robust emphasis on data privacy and ethical AI. The GDPR has provided a framework that fosters the creation of trustworthy and transparent intelligent apps. The European Union is investing in AI research and innovation via initiatives like Horizon Europe, which is designed to strengthen the competitiveness of the region in the global technology arena.

Germany is one of Europe's leading markets with a robust industrial sector and emphasis on Industry 4.0. Intelligent apps are being utilized by German businesses to establish smart factories and streamline their production processes. In 2025, the German Federal Office for Information Security remained central to the country's technology assurance and incident coordination. The office's set policy focuses on national resilience and public-private partnership, which is a solid pillar for the development of the intelligent apps market.

The UK is also a lucrative market, with a lively tech startup ecosystem and a keen emphasis on AI research. The UK government has recognized AI as a priority area and is investing in initiatives to drive the development of the AI industry. In May 2025, the UK's National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C) launched new assurance plans at CYBERUK 2025. These plans aim to support organizations in proving their resilience and establishing national confidence in managing cyber risk, important to enable the mass adoption of smart apps.

In 2025, the industry size of intelligent apps is estimated at USD 45 billion.

The global intelligent apps market size was valued at USD 45 billion in 2025 and is estimated to reach USD 629.9 billion by the end of 2035, expanding at a CAGR of 30.2% throughout the forecast period, from 2026 to 2035. By the end of 2026, the intelligent apps industry size is poised to reach USD 58.5 billion.

Key players in the market are Google LLC, Microsoft Corporation, Amazon Web Services, Inc., Apple Inc., SAP SE, Salesforce, Inc., Oracle Corporation, IBM Corporation,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d., Baidu, Inc., Infosys Limited.

The BFSI segment is anticipated to lead the intelligent apps market during the forecast period.

North America is anticipated to dominate the intelligent apps market during the forecast period.
